May 5, 2020

China launches new experimental crew spacecraft, testing out its deep-space ambitions

Posted by in category: space travel

On May 4th, China launched a pivotal new rocket called the Long March 5B, carrying a prototype deep-space spacecraft into orbit around Earth. The successful launch is meant to test out the country’s plans for sending humans to deep space, and it paves the way for the country’s ambitious space projects in the year ahead.

